Louis-Antoine Denault is a goaltender selected by the Florida Panthers in the seventh round (217th overall) of the 2026 NHL Draft — and at 6-foot-8, the tallest goaltender in the entire draft class. He is, in fact, taller than every goaltender currently in the NHL; NHL.com noted that if he stepped into the league today he would stand above even 6-foot-7 Ivan Fedotov.

Born September 26, 2006 in Quebec City, the left-catching giant grew up playing basketball, which scouts credit for the unusual mobility and lower-body athleticism he carries on such a large frame. His path was a climb the Québec press dubbed "the giant who got back up": undrafted into the QMJHL, passed over in the 2025 NHL Draft, and slowed by injury and a difficult stretch, he fought back, was traded to the expansion Newfoundland Regiment in December 2025, and became their starter — going 16-7 with a .913 save percentage to earn his selection.

"At his height, someone with that kind of athletic ability doesn't come along every day," his former Quebec Remparts coach Éric Veilleux told NHL.com. This page gathers Denault's numbers, measurements, and draft details in one place. InGoal Magazine will expand its coverage as his career develops.

Why did the Florida Panthers draft Louis-Antoine Denault?

It follows a Panthers tradition. As Panthers reporter George Richards (@GeorgeRichards on X) put it after the pick: “The Florida Panthers give Roberto Luongo the seventh round to pick a goalie every year — and they are usually quite tall. Today’s pick: 6-foot-8 Louis-Antoine Denault.” At 6-foot-8, Denault fits the mold.

How did Louis-Antoine Denault reach the QMJHL?

As a walk-on. An undrafted prep goalie out of Académie Saint-Louis — where he was named Male Athlete of the Year and even played junior basketball — he earned a Quebec Remparts roster spot over four drafted goalies, then played the season opener in front of 10,000-plus at the Centre Vidéotron, the rink where he had grown up watching games. Florida had him at their development camp a full year before drafting him.

How does a 6-foot-8 goalie move so well?

A basketball background. Scouts credit his youth basketball for unusual lower-body athleticism and mobility on such a large frame, along with exceptional lower-net coverage.
